This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A913168E/143D02548C2311ED90AE9710C4F9AE02/40EB2FD68C2511EDB64DB410C4F9AE02.roa
File:                     40EB2FD68C2511EDB64DB410C4F9AE02.roa (raw, json)
Hash identifier:          OCV4bYH3X6n3Gb49xPR0lidOH2XxGNObq/1usAZiyZY=
Subject key identifier:   2C:83:57:0D:51:50:A9:87:0C:F6:F5:F2:D8:08:F3:E7:AA:26:1B:C8
Certificate issuer:       /CN=A913168E/serialNumber=AEB89C026FE9552A150B03C30AA0CDC479D1E2A1
Certificate serial:       0237
Authority key identifier: AE:B8:9C:02:6F:E9:55:2A:15:0B:03:C3:0A:A0:CD:C4:79:D1:E2:A1
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/rricAm_pVSoVCwPDCqDNxHnR4qE.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A913168E/143D02548C2311ED90AE9710C4F9AE02/40EB2FD68C2511EDB64DB410C4F9AE02.roa
Signing time:             Wed 31 Dec 2025 01:21:50 +0000
ROA not before:           Wed 31 Dec 2025 01:21:50 +0000
ROA not after:            Tue 02 Mar 2027 00:00:00 +0000
asID:                     131471
IP address blocks:        103.47.180.0/24 maxlen: 24
                          103.47.181.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A913168E/143D02548C2311ED90AE9710C4F9AE02/rricAm_pVSoVCwPDCqDNxHnR4qE.crl
                          rsync://rpki.apnic.net/member_repository/A913168E/143D02548C2311ED90AE9710C4F9AE02/rricAm_pVSoVCwPDCqDNxHnR4qE.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/rricAm_pVSoVCwPDCqDNxHnR4qE.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sun 01 Feb 2026 01:12:08 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 567 (0x237)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A913168E, serialNumber=AEB89C026FE9552A150B03C30AA0CDC479D1E2A1
        Validity
            Not Before: Dec 31 01:21:50 2025 GMT
            Not After : Mar  2 00:00:00 2027 GMT
        Subject: CN=69547aae-9f6c
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:9f:49:34:26:06:e3:b5:87:77:2d:c9:62:82:ee:
                    ec:0b:b1:97:ca:34:ae:1d:8c:54:08:dc:89:5d:46:
                    70:83:e8:87:84:f2:8c:cd:2d:5f:76:cd:c3:4b:5c:
                    ab:0d:49:1a:3b:2d:2d:8d:52:4f:c2:31:e9:c9:62:
                    56:fb:19:ee:b1:cd:39:0e:ff:a1:e4:03:9d:45:92:
                    ee:2d:da:8b:14:e5:ea:1b:83:97:cf:24:61:34:c8:
                    a6:f9:34:be:1e:c3:6b:60:d8:b7:c9:87:7a:1a:72:
                    1d:68:b7:b6:6f:47:b6:86:6f:a8:00:12:6f:d9:e3:
                    c5:7f:15:b2:c2:a2:45:1c:06:92:0f:a4:45:f3:77:
                    5d:f2:be:d5:a9:50:b3:13:9c:4a:ad:2a:c3:8e:41:
                    ba:2b:36:bc:40:20:20:11:eb:42:ba:b8:00:bf:e1:
                    89:42:8b:cb:33:21:ab:e9:e0:98:49:56:54:fa:e7:
                    17:a2:a2:81:67:99:cc:35:33:d2:ab:7a:f6:6d:23:
                    bc:12:61:87:f5:7d:4d:9b:fe:71:ef:74:4c:80:a5:
                    38:1f:12:1b:dc:da:b2:40:69:c1:d1:64:3a:2d:b8:
                    91:35:51:eb:91:72:87:80:2f:a9:aa:6d:63:9f:b5:
                    95:ef:7d:3d:0a:57:32:12:92:17:e8:8c:c8:02:75:
                    30:87
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                2C:83:57:0D:51:50:A9:87:0C:F6:F5:F2:D8:08:F3:E7:AA:26:1B:C8
            X509v3 Authority Key Identifier:
                keyid:AE:B8:9C:02:6F:E9:55:2A:15:0B:03:C3:0A:A0:CD:C4:79:D1:E2:A1

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A913168E/143D02548C2311ED90AE9710C4F9AE02/rricAm_pVSoVCwPDCqDNxHnR4qE.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/rricAm_pVSoVCwPDCqDNxHnR4qE.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A913168E/143D02548C2311ED90AE9710C4F9AE02/40EB2FD68C2511EDB64DB410C4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.47.180.0/23

    Signature Algorithm: sha256WithRSAEncryption
         ab:c5:d0:c2:05:c8:1a:89:f2:a8:f6:88:22:1c:71:20:7a:74:
         81:e7:2a:48:6a:60:07:8a:5f:d3:c2:e7:a5:df:81:c0:b1:42:
         50:32:76:2a:ab:fd:9d:28:e8:f9:1f:2f:19:7b:4c:56:1e:c1:
         9b:48:5f:fa:68:fb:b3:b2:31:6c:37:a2:85:f5:9c:d6:94:46:
         57:80:d6:c0:16:95:ac:86:09:ae:e4:cd:8c:8d:e6:ff:06:1b:
         e0:cf:a0:2d:e2:24:0b:14:8f:66:8e:a3:17:b6:43:99:7c:8e:
         cd:16:d9:bb:30:23:18:3c:fb:24:05:c8:59:b1:db:e1:a4:0a:
         e8:de:8d:52:63:00:b1:92:4e:f7:f4:8e:f1:9c:71:c1:0a:b0:
         d9:2b:9c:5f:d8:c6:12:2e:3a:a6:4c:2e:5c:c1:30:77:23:45:
         4f:71:38:2b:ac:4e:50:bc:57:54:32:e5:b2:6c:d2:3f:ab:36:
         5a:32:08:64:88:eb:cc:d5:f7:c0:e1:e3:58:e7:3e:74:4b:7f:
         48:2c:30:f5:4d:12:b3:40:f6:a4:4e:e6:2d:d5:d6:87:ec:c1:
         35:9f:05:d5:51:a2:54:33:61:d2:c5:34:c2:c7:a6:af:42:5d:
         5e:b9:c6:31:82:55:2a:bc:31:b2:b1:a1:35:da:de:72:7c:8a:
         e8:e5:dd:ef
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ICAjcw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AwwIQTkx
MzE2OEUxMTAvBgNVBAUTKEFFQjg5QzAyNkZFOTU1MkExNTBCMDNDMzBBQTBDREM0
NzlEMUUyQTEwHhcNMjUxMjMxMDEyMTUwWhcNMjcwMzAyMDAwMDAwWjAYMRYwFAYD
VQQDDA02OTU0N2FhZS05ZjZjMI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An0k0JgbjtYd3Lcligu7sC7GXyjSuHYxUCNyJXUZwg+iHhPKMzS1fds3DS1yr
DUkaOy0tjVJPwjHpyWJW+xnusc05Dv+h5AOdRZLuLdqLFOXqG4OXzyRhNMim+TS+
HsNrYNi3yYd6GnIdaLe2b0e2hm+oABJv2ePFfxWywqJFHAaSD6RF83dd8r7VqVCz
E5xKrSrDjkG6Kza8QCAgEetCurgAv+GJQovLMyGr6eCYSVZU+ucXoqKBZ5nMNTPS
q3r2bSO8EmGH9X1Nm/5x73RMgKU4HxIb3NqyQGnB0WQ6LbiRNVHrkXKHgC+pqm1j
n7WV7309ClcyEpIX6IzIAnUwhwIDAQABo4IClTCCApEwHQYDVR0OBBYEFCyDVw1R
UKmHDPb18tgI8+eqJhvIMB8GA1UdIwQYMBaAFK64nAJv6VUqFQsDwwqgzcR50eKh
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TEzMTY4RS8xNDNEMDI1NDhD
MjMxMUVEOTBBRTk3MTBDNEY5QUUwMi9ycmljQW1fcFZTb1ZDd1BEQ3FETnhIblI0
cUUu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L3JyaWNBbV9wVlNvVkN3UERDcUROeEhuUjRxRS5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
MzE2OEUvMTQzRDAyNTQ4QzIzMTFFRDkwQUU5NzEwQzRGOUFFMDIvNDBFQjJGRDY4
QzI1MTFFREI2NERCNDEwQz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BAFnL7QwDQYJKoZIhvcNAQELBQADggEBAKvF0MIFyBqJ8qj2
iCIccSB6dIHnKkhqYAeKX9PC56XfgcCxQlAydiqr/Z0o6PkfLxl7TFYewZtIX/po
+7OyMWw3ooX1nNaURleA1sAWlayGCa7kzYyN5v8GG+DPoC3iJAsUj2aOoxe2Q5l8
js0W2bswIxg8+yQFyFmx2+GkCujejVJjALGSTvf0jvGcccEKsNkrnF/YxhIuOqZM
LlzBMHcjRU9xOCusTlC8V1Qy5bJs0j+rNloyCGSI68zV98Dh41jnPnRLf0gsMPVN
ErNA9qRO5i3V1ofswTWfBdVRolQzYdLFNMLHpq9CXV65xjGCVSq8MbKxoTXa3nJ8
iujl3e8=
-----END CERTIFICATE-----
Generated at Sun Jan 25 06:07:39 2026 by rpki-client